For the first time in twelve seasons, Ryan Murphy has left his post as showrunner. Newcomer Halley Feiffer is tasked with adapting the novel “Delicate Condition,” written by Danielle Valentine. This slow-burn film follows the descent into hell of Anna Alcott, an actress who is struggling to have a child.
After a miscarriage and yet another IVF, she succeeds, but her joy is short-lived. She feels haunted, experiences intense physical changes, and thinks an evil entity is looking for her baby. The series takes up this premise, with Emma Roberts, a familiar face of AHSin the main role.

Pregnancy anxiety is a recurring theme in the horror genre, such as Rosemary’s Baby (1968). The writer Danielle Valentine explains what inspired her Alien (Ridley Scott, 1979) for his story:
“It’s a little ironic that a group of men looked for the scariest thing they could think of, and came up with the idea that there might be something growing in your body, that you have no control over, that does these things to you. things. , and eventually it comes out of you. Basically, they just wrote a story about pregnancy.”
The news is that from the novel to its adaptation, including the production (Jessica Yu and Jennifer Lynch give their aesthetic touch to the season), AHS Delicate count the thinkers, who place this season on the side of the female gaze. And it works quite well if you’re a fan of time-consuming psychological thrillers.
In the body and mind of a pregnant woman
Anna Alcott is certainly not a composition role for Emma Roberts: she herself is a famous actress, she recently gave birth to a baby boy, while continuing his career in this privileged and carnivorous environment. And it’s no easy task: in the series, Anna juggles her appointments at the fertility clinic, her insecurities pushed aside by her loved ones, and the promotion of her latest film, which could win her an Oscar and boost her career. career like never before. . The series transcribes both disturbing bodily changes what Anna is going through (bleeding teeth, loose nails or more simply, a persistent pimple on her face that haunts her) and what’s on her mind.

Physical alerts force Anna to see her gynecologist again, which is not exactly reassuring. She also feels spied on, by an obsessive fan or by something even more worrying… Behind her is the façade of her understanding husband, her husband, Dex, doesn’t believe her, and he’s not her only one . No one around her takes her seriously. He is told to rest, that the hormones and medications are playing tricks on him… A terribly frustrating situation to consider gas lightingwhich will speak to many women and in particular to those who have lived the experience of pregnancy. You have to have a strong heart to watch AHS Delicate who takes the scalpel on issues such as obstetric violence (the scariest scenes), miscarriage or perinatal bereavement.
Kim K, the pleasant surprise
Faced with a solid Emma Roberts in the complicated role of a woman whose sufferings we do not listen to, we were curiously awaiting the performance of Kim Kardashian, a newcomer to the glam and bloody world ofAmerican horror story. So far the star has stood out mostly in her reality shows about her family. She plays Siobhan Corbyni, Anna’s PR and best friend. And from the first dialogue (“Tell the Daniels to suck my clit!”), it’s like a fish in water! Her scenes with Emma Roberts wake us up, in the heart of a thriller that sometimes lacks rhythm. Surrounded by public relations people, Kim K takes evident pleasure in embodying this half-comforting, half-worrying boss figure. We are no longer wary of the arrival of another celebrity, Cara Delevingne, who struggles to establish herself in a more subtle role as an unidentified villain.

Trans actress Mj Rodriguez also joins AHS this season, as Nicolette Smith, a housekeeper and new mother. If her character is not explicitly trans (for the moment the rest of the season will air in 2024), the introductory scene, which sees her expressing milk in front of Anna, necessarily has something political at a time when transphobia is raging . AHS Delicate it is therefore part of the continuity ofa horror series that has always given pride of place to female characters.
